How do you need me to grow?

When I entered the labyrinth, I was in the midst of a faith struggle, so it made sense that my unspoken question was about my need to grow in that area.

In faith. Trust me.

It is impossible to have a healthy, nurturing relationship without having trust.

Trust is necessary in our faith journey, as much as it is in any other relationship.

I don’t deny that “surrender” in matters of faith is a struggle for me.

In relationship with me.

Good faith relationships are a two way street of give and take: Give him praise; Accept his grace, mercy & love.

It sounds easy, and I’m sure I make it harder than necessary.  All good relationships are the result of genuine effort, desire and work.

I know I have work to do.

The Messiah your heart longs for wants a relationship with you!

Understand that there will be interruptions along the way.

There are things in the Bible that are HARD to reconcile with our belief in a loving and merciful God.  This is was my reminder that doubt, which can interrupt our efforts to deepen our relationship with God, is OK. 

It’s an interruption, not a cessation.
